Abstract

A crankshaft that can be strengthened in a short time without being subjected to wasteful processing, and that can be strengthened over a wide range. The crankshaft includes a crank pin and a fillet portion of a journal pin. Compressive residual stress is applied to a region on the fillet portion, which extends at almost equal distances to both sides in a circumferential direction from a portion in which the greatest bending load is applied, and a processing depth for applying the compressive residual stress is gradually decreased in a circumferential direction from the center position in which the compressive residual stress is greatest.
